This weekend, a car accident in Bremerton took the life of an 18- year-old sailor stationed at Naval Base Kitsap-Bangor. The tragic accident happened at around 3:30 p.m. on Saturday, April 10.

Mark S. Schroeder was driving south on Highway 3 when he lost control of his vehicle, crashing into a power pole.

Sadly, Schroeder died instantly at the scene of the collision. All three passengers inside the car were injured. They suffered only minor injuries and were taken to a nearby hospital. Two have been released. There is no word on the current condition of the third passenger.

All occupants were wearing seatbelts at the time of the crash. Investigators do not believe drugs or alcohol contributed to the accident.
